When searching for "windows and doors near me," several aspects need to be examined to identify the very best choices:
Material: Common products for windows and doors consist of wood, vinyl, aluminum, and fiberglass. Each has its own maintenance requirements, insulative residential or commercial properties, and visual appeals.
Energy Efficiency: Look for windows and doors with an Energy Star rating. These products help to decrease energy expenses by keeping your home warm during winter and cool throughout summertime.
Style Compatibility: Select windows and doors that boost the architectural design of your home. Standard homes look best with classic styles, while modern homes can gain from structured styles.
Spending plan: Setting a clear budget plan can help limit options. Consider not only initial costs but likewise long-lasting energy savings.
Regional Climate: Depending on the local weather condition patterns, some materials work much better than others. For example, homes in damp areas may require various door materials compared to those in dry or snowy environments.

What is the best type of window for energy effectiveness?
Double-pane windows are typically best for energy efficiency, as they trap air between the panes, offering much better insulation.
How typically should windows and doors be changed?
Usually, windows and doors ought to be changed every 15-30 years, depending on wear, damage, and energy loss.
What functions should I try to find in patio doors?
Try to find features such as energy-efficient glass, strong locks for security, and ease of operation.
How can I improve the energy effectiveness of existing windows?
Consider window treatments, caulking, or setting up storm windows as potentials for enhancing energy performance.
Do I need a license to change windows and doors?
The requirement for a license varies by location. It's suggested to consult local structure authorities.
